--tamientos Spanish suffix derived from Latin '-mentum', forming a noun indicating action or result.
sustentamientos
5 syllables15 letters
sus·ten·ta·mien·tos
/sus.ten.taˈmjen.tos/
noun
The word 'sustentamientos' is divided into five syllables: sus-ten-ta-mien-tos. The stress falls on the penultimate syllable ('mien'). It's a noun derived from Latin roots, meaning 'supports' or 'foundations'. Syllabification follows standard CV and VCV rules, with penultimate stress applying due to the word ending in 's'.
